Stability and Growth of Payments

Fetching dividends data

Stable Dividend: Whilst dividend payments have been stable, SHO has been paying a dividend for less than 10 years.

Growing Dividend: SHO's dividend payments have increased, but the company has only paid a dividend for 2 years.

Notable Dividend: SHO's dividend (1.55%) isn’t notable compared to the bottom 25% of dividend payers in the Polish market (2.7%).

High Dividend: SHO's dividend (1.55%) is low compared to the top 25% of dividend payers in the Polish market (7.78%).


Earnings Payout to Shareholders

Earnings Coverage: With its reasonable payout ratio (62.6%), SHO's dividend payments are covered by earnings.


Cash Payout to Shareholders

Cash Flow Coverage: With its reasonably low cash payout ratio (46%), SHO's dividend payments are well covered by cash flows.
